
数据关联与数据合并的区别
在数据处理和分析的过程中,数据关联和数据合并是两个常见的操作。尽管它们在某些方面相似,但各自的目标、方法和应用场景有所不同。以下是对这两个概念的详细解析和比较。
一、定义及目标
数据关联:
- 定义:数据关联是指在不同数据集之间建立连接或关系的过程,以便能够跨多个数据集进行查询和分析。
- 目标:通过关联不同来源的数据集,揭示数据之间的潜在联系,提供更全面的信息视图。
数据合并:
- 定义:数据合并是将两个或多个数据集组合成一个单一数据集的操作,通常涉及将字段值相加、拼接或覆盖等。
- 目标:通过合并数据集,简化数据分析过程,消除重复数据,并创建一个统一的数据视图。
二、操作方法
数据关联:
- 方法:数据关联通常依赖于共同的关键字段(如ID、日期等)来建立连接。常见的关联类型包括内连接、左连接、右连接和全连接。
- 工具:数据库管理系统(DBMS)、SQL查询语言、数据处理软件(如Python的Pandas库)等常用于执行数据关联操作。
数据合并:
- 方法:数据合并可以通过简单的字段相加、记录拼接或使用特定的合并规则来实现。例如,可以将两个具有相同结构的表格按行或列进行合并。
- 工具:电子表格软件(如Excel)、编程语言(如Python、R)以及数据库管理系统中的合并功能等均可用于数据合并。
三、应用场景
数据关联:
- 适用场景:当需要分析来自不同数据源的信息时,数据关联非常有用。例如,在客户关系管理系统中,可能需要将客户订单信息与客户信息相关联,以获取完整的购买历史。
- 优势:能够揭示跨数据集的关系,提高分析的准确性和深度。
数据合并:
- 适用场景:当需要将多个数据集整合为一个统一的视图时,数据合并是理想的选择。例如,在市场调研中,可能需要将来自不同调查渠道的数据合并到一个综合报告中。
- 优势:简化了数据结构,提高了数据的可读性和易用性。
四、注意事项
- 在进行数据关联时,应确保关键字段的唯一性和准确性,以避免错误的连接结果。
- 在进行数据合并时,应注意处理重复数据和不一致的格式,以确保合并后的数据集质量。
- 根据具体需求选择合适的关联或合并策略,以达到最佳的分析效果。
综上所述,数据关联和数据合并虽然都是数据处理中的重要步骤,但它们的目标、方法和应用场景存在显著差异。在实际应用中,应根据具体需求选择合适的方法,并结合适当的工具和技巧来提高数据处理和分析的效率和质量。
